Oonagh O’Mahony to represent Ireland at the IFAJ-Alltech Young Leaders in Agricultural Journalism Bootcamp

Congratulations to Oonagh O’Mahony from IFP Media who was selected to represent Ireland at the IFAJ-Alltech Young Leaders in Agricultural Journalism Bootcamp.

Journalists from across the world enter the prestigious awards and 10 are selected to attend the bootcamp which coincides with the IFAJ congress in the Netherlands. Oonagh has been a valued member of the Guild of Agricultural Journalists for many years and of course, was our previous chair and we know she will be a fantastic Irish representative.
The IFAJ Awards will also take place during the congress. Following the Irish judging, we are delighted to announce that in the print category, Thomas Hubert and Pat O’Toole from the Irish Farmers Journal will represent Ireland with their piece on the campaign by the Revenue Commissioners to generate additional tax streams from Kerry Co-op shareholders.

In the digital category, Thomas also received first place in the Irish judging for his piece on building a dairy industry from the ground up in Kenya.

We wish them both the best of luck and hope there will be Irish win in Netherlands.
